| Index: chrome/browser/android/offline_pages/offline_page_model_factory.cc
|
| diff --git a/chrome/browser/android/offline_pages/offline_page_model_factory.cc b/chrome/browser/android/offline_pages/offline_page_model_factory.cc
|
| index b9992863bb75c8d541336717ca4e23ac939b7316..c8206a6bd8cc1e4c35fcf4a301b4eef09116b9d2 100644
|
| --- a/chrome/browser/android/offline_pages/offline_page_model_factory.cc
|
| +++ b/chrome/browser/android/offline_pages/offline_page_model_factory.cc
|
| @@ -9,6 +9,7 @@
|
| #include "base/files/file_path.h"
|
| #include "base/memory/singleton.h"
|
| #include "base/sequenced_task_runner.h"
|
| +#include "chrome/browser/browser_process.h"
|
| #include "chrome/browser/profiles/incognito_helpers.h"
|
| #include "chrome/browser/profiles/profile.h"
|
| #include "chrome/common/chrome_constants.h"
|
| @@ -16,6 +17,7 @@
|
| #include "components/offline_pages/offline_page_metadata_store_sql.h"
|
| #include "components/offline_pages/offline_page_model.h"
|
| #include "components/offline_pages/proto/offline_pages.pb.h"
|
| +#include "components/rappor/rappor_service.h"
|
| #include "content/public/browser/browser_thread.h"
|
|
|
| namespace offline_pages {
|
| @@ -54,6 +56,7 @@ KeyedService* OfflinePageModelFactory::BuildServiceInstanceFor(
|
| profile->GetPath().Append(chrome::kOfflinePageArchviesDirname);
|
|
|
| return new OfflinePageModel(std::move(metadata_store), archives_dir,
|
| + g_browser_process->rappor_service()->AsWeakPtr(),
|
| background_task_runner);
|
| }
|
|
|
|
|